what does code P0301 mean for my BMW 3 Series F30/F31 (2012-2019)

BMW 3 Series F30/F31 (2012-2019)

Problem Statement

## Problem Statement The diagnostic trouble code (DTC) P0301 indicates a cylinder 1 misfire in a BMW 3 Series F30/F31 (2012-2019). This misfire may lead to performance issues and increased emissions.

Symptoms

  • •Check engine light illuminated
  • •Rough idle or engine shaking
  • •Loss of power during acceleration
  • •Poor fuel economy
  • •Increased exhaust emissions

Diagnostic Steps

  1. 1Scan the vehicle’s onboard computer using an OBD-II scanner to confirm the P0301 code.
  2. 2Inspect the ignition coil and spark plug of cylinder 1 for visible damage or wear.
  3. 3Check for vacuum leaks around the intake manifold and throttle body.
  4. 4Perform a compression test on cylinder 1 to assess engine health.
  5. 5Verify fuel injector operation for cylinder 1 using a noid light or multimeter.
  6. 6Inspect wiring and connectors related to cylinder 1 for damage or corrosion.

Solution

Solution

1. Preparation

  • Gather necessary tools and parts.
  • Ensure the vehicle is on a level surface and the engine is cool.
  • Disconnect the negative battery terminal for safety.

2. Replace Spark Plug

  • Remove the ignition coil from cylinder 1:
    • Unscrew any retaining bolts and disconnect the electrical connector.
  • Remove the spark plug using a spark plug socket and ratchet:
    • Inspect the spark plug for wear or deposits.
  • Install a new spark plug:
    • Torque to the manufacturer’s specifications (usually around 22 lb-ft).

3. Replace Ignition Coil

  • If the spark plug is in good condition, inspect the ignition coil:
    • If damaged, install a new ignition coil for cylinder 1.
  • Reconnect the electrical connector and secure the coil in place.

4. Inspect Fuel Injector

  • Check the fuel injector for cylinder 1:
    • Remove the fuel rail if necessary.
  • Clean or replace the injector as needed:
    • Ensure proper seating and reattach any connectors.

5. Reassemble and Clear Codes

  • Reinstall any components removed during the process.
  • Reconnect the negative battery terminal.
  • Use the OBD-II scanner to clear the error codes.
